Four Nepali migrants infected with COVID-19 in Spain



KATHMANDU: Four Nepali migrant workers have been infected with the COVID-19 in Spain.

They have been undergoing treatment at different hospitals in Catalonia in the north-east region of Spain, confirmed Nepali Embassy in Spain.

Nepali Ambassador to Spain Dawa Futi Sherpa said the Embassy has received the information  about the coronavirus infection in the four Nepali migrant workers.

A Nepali national staying at Barcelona, Sadagra Familia has been hospitalized at Sant Pau Hospital while the remaining three are from Hospital De Lliria. They have been receiving treatment at a hospital based in the area.

The details of the patients have, however, been kept confidential. According to sources, all the infected are males. The condition of one among them is said to be critical.

Catalonia in the north-east region of Spain has seen a rapid increase in cases, of late.

The number of deaths in Spain has soared to 4,365 after 931 people died in 24 hours on Thursday. Over 57,786 people have been infected.
